In silico predictors
PROVEAN | PolyPhen-2 | BLAST-PSSM | REVEL | Penetrance Density BrS (%) | Penetrance Density LQT3 (%) |
---|---|---|---|---|---|
-4.84 | 0.491 | -1.64 | 0.914 | 25 | 2 |
PROVEAN scores below -2 suggest deleterious impact. REVEL scores above 0.5–0.75 are often interpreted as likely pathogenic. PolyPhen-2 scores above 0.85 are typically pathogenic. Penetrance density summarises neighbouring residue risk (Kroncke et al. 2019).
